Skip to content


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Commits on Feb 12, 2011
  1. @joshvarner @jitter

    Remove sed from post-build code, due to portability issues between GN…

    joshvarner authored jitter committed
    …U and BSD versions.
    Follow up to ba43d37 which apparently
    didn't fix the problem completly on Mac OS X.
Commits on Jan 26, 2011
  1. @jitter

    Fix Makefile to use plain sed agin. Remove unicode trickery. Thanks t…

    jitter authored
    …o danheberden and gnarf for figuring out why it previously faild on Mac OS X.
  2. @jeresig

    Make sure that init is run before jquery is built (avoiding weird war…

    jeresig authored
    …nings when running 'make jquery' or 'make min'). Additionally only attempt to run JSLint or the minifier if NodeJS is installed (avoiding a weird warning when you first run 'make' or 'make all').
Commits on Jan 24, 2011
  1. @jeresig
  2. @jitter
Commits on Jan 19, 2011
  1. @danheberden
Commits on Jan 18, 2011
  1. @csnover

    Clarify cygwin instructions slightly and swap the order of arguments …

    csnover authored
    …to which in Makefile because of a bug in current versions of MSYS that causes only the first argument to /bin/which to be searched.
  2. @csnover
  3. @csnover

    Replace build system with a faster new one that uses Node and UglifyJ…

    csnover authored
    …S and generates smaller minified files. Also removes builds through rake/ant since having 3 different build systems was too much to maintain (make was the only one consistently kept up-to-date). Fixes #7973.
Commits on Jan 6, 2011
  1. @jaubourg

    Renamed src/transports to src/ajax (in case we need prefilters in the…

    jaubourg authored
    … future and to avoid a separate prefilters directory).
Commits on Dec 31, 2010
  1. @jaubourg

    Removed re-usability from jXHR object (no more open, send & onreadyst…

    jaubourg authored
    …atechange support). Streamlined the implementation and put it back into ajax.js (removed xhr.js in the process). Went back to a more simple & direct approach to options handling (keeping much room to further minification-related optimizations). Code is cleaner, smaller & faster. Removed & edited unit tests accordingly. All build files have had xhr.js removed.
Commits on Dec 30, 2010
  1. @zimbatm @csnover

    Update Rakefile to remove module wrappers (feature parity with make a…

    zimbatm authored csnover committed
    …nd ant). Update Makefile to avoid rebuilding jquery.js when it is not necessary to do so.
  2. @csnover
Commits on Dec 10, 2010
  1. Replaced spaces with a tab in Makefile.

    jaubourg authored
Commits on Dec 9, 2010
  1. @jeresig

    Rewrite of the Ajax module by Julian Aubourg. Some (dated) details ca…

    jaubourg authored jeresig committed
    …n be found here: more details are forthcoming. Fixes #7195.
Commits on Oct 23, 2010
  1. @jeresig
Commits on Oct 14, 2010
  1. @jeresig
Commits on Oct 11, 2010
  1. @jeresig
Commits on Sep 22, 2010
  1. @azatoth @jeresig

    Makefile: cleanup

    azatoth authored jeresig committed
    * updating init to either pull or clone, not do both
    * make sure it building only when it needs to
    * make some variables overridable
    * use variables when they should be used instead of direct text
    * add V verbosity variable
Commits on Sep 9, 2010
  1. @jeresig
Commits on Jul 21, 2010
  1. @rdworth @jeresig

    Minor fix to Makefile so that 'make clean' doesn't fail when run imme…

    rdworth authored jeresig committed
    …diately after 'make clean'
  2. @rdworth @jeresig

    Simplified getting the commit date using git log --pretty. Fixed miss…

    rdworth authored jeresig committed
    …ing date in ant build.
Commits on Mar 2, 2010
  1. @jeresig

    Remove the need for the return in sizzle-jquery and just remove the a…

    jeresig authored
    …ttempt to expose Sizzle completely. jQuery is 100% passing JSLint ('make lint') now.
  2. @jeresig

    Added in integrated JSLint checking against the jQuery source. Just r…

    jeresig authored
    …un 'make lint' to see the result.
Commits on Feb 10, 2010
  1. @irae @jeresig
Commits on Jan 28, 2010
  1. @jeresig

    Add a new build mode to the Makefile that doesn't try to pull from ex…

    jeresig authored
    …ternal sources (assumes that they're already built and not changing frequently).
Commits on Jan 13, 2010
  1. @jeresig

    Fixed typo in logic, also disabled function setters in this case to a…

    jeresig authored
    …llow the functions to passthrough and bind.
Commits on Jan 12, 2010
  1. @jeresig
  2. @jeresig
Commits on Dec 31, 2009
  1. @jeresig

    Allow the Makefile to be more resiliant to broken builds and handle r…

    jeresig authored
    …edirecting the output better in more shells. Thanks to 'candlerb' on jquery-dev for the suggestion.
Commits on Dec 19, 2009
  1. @jeresig

    Switched from using YUI Compressor to Google Compiler. Minified and G…

    jeresig authored
    …zipped filesize reduced to 22,839 bytes from 26,169 bytes (13% decrease in filesize). Sizzle copyright was merged into the main header (since it's removed automatically). Still passes all unit tests.
Commits on Dec 18, 2009
  1. @jeresig
Commits on Dec 7, 2009
  1. @jeresig

    support.js needs to come before event.js (also placed in a temporary …

    jeresig authored
    …setTimeout to delay the introduction of the ready in support - will remove when ready is moved to core.js, likely later today).
Commits on Dec 6, 2009
  1. @jeresig

    Split the queue code out from data.js into a dedicated queue.js file …

    jeresig authored
    …(also split tests accordingly).
Commits on Nov 30, 2009
  1. @jeresig

    Shortened the build messages in the Makefile and added test/qunit and…

    jeresig authored
    … src/sizzle to the cleanup.
Something went wrong with that request. Please try again.